I think we have great potential for this year but lets pump the brakes here for a second on the automatically throwing us into tier 1. Yes we return a lot and yes there isn't a game on our schedule I don't expect us to compete in- but this is also a team that has won 8 total games the past 2 years and has defeated exactly 1 ranked opponent since 2012.

Navy is going to win 6 games minimum. They've won at least 6 games in 12 out of the last 13 seasons and the one year they didn't they went 5-7. Is it fair to expect them to go 11-2 again? Probably not. But I'd expect them to be much closer to 8-4 than 4-8.

ECU and Tulsa are in the right spot as Tulsa has no D and ECU has no QB.

I think Memphis is again minimum a bowl team. There was talent on that team besides Lynch and I don't think you can just point to the bowl game as evidence they're going to regress because 1. Lynch played and 2. They looked totally unmotivated and that happens in bowls sometimes (see Cincinnati in the Hawaii Bowl).

Navy lost two 1,000 yard rushers. They lost their best QB ever and their thumper. They lose their entire starting offense line, all five positions. They could easily slide below .500.
